Why is demand for residential energy storage growing?
Reduction in the per-kilowatt-hour cost of a residential energy storage system in recent years is contributing to growing demand for residential energy storage systems. Increasing need of grid resilience during mass-grid outages is a key factor contributing to growing demand for energy storage in the residential sector in developed countries.

What is residential energy storage?
Residential energy storage helps battery-equipped households to minimize the amount of power consumed during periods of peak prices, which has been increasing utilization in recent years.
